These facilities focus primarily on rehabilitating patients from opioid dependency, which encompasses a range of substances including prescription painkillers, heroin, and synthetic opioids. The multifaceted approach utilized by these rehab centers often combines medical detoxification with therapeutic interventions, counseling, and group support, which are crucial in addressing both the physical and psychological aspects of addiction. The history of opioid rehab centers in Stafford is deeply intertwined with the national opioid crisis, marking a significant response to one of the most pressing public health issues in recent years. Since the early 2000s, as opioid prescriptions escalated and overdoses became increasingly fatal, rehab centers began to offer targeted solutions aimed at education, prevention, and recovery. The impact of these facilities has been profound, not only on individual patients but also on the community as a whole, through reducing stigma, raising awareness of addiction, and fostering a supportive recovery environment. As rehabilitation technology evolves and new treatment methods surface, the centers in Stafford continue to adapt, achieving considerable success in restoring lives and rebuilding families affected by the opioid epidemic.
